The primary goal of this fieldwork is to explore the political behavior of persons with disabilities in India. While existing research has largely focused on the United States and other Western democracies, we have limited scientific understanding of how disability intersects with political behavior in different institutional, political, and cultural contexts. This study seeks to begin filling that gap.
Although my long-term objective is to make causal claims about the drivers of political behavior among persons with disabilities (which will require a quantitative approach to hypothesis testing), the literature on the political behavior of persons with disabilities is not yet sufficiently mature to produce a satisfying set of hypotheses about these drivers. Therefore, I will begin with an exploratory, qualitative approach to theory building and hypothesis generation.
Research activities will include:
Conducting semi-structured interviews
Conducting survey
